About the event
This hands-on workshop will introduce two traditional craft practices using cattail leaves: basketry and paper making. Renee Baumann will teach a small leaf-shaped rib basket, introducing foundational weaving techniques. Roberta Trentin will guide teaching paper making, and participants will get to experience transforming plant matter into a workable pulp, and how to make handmade sheets of paper. Together, these complementary practices offer a practical, beginner-friendly way to work with natural materials and to understand how a single plant can support multiple forms of making. Expect to leave with a small completed basket and several sheets of handmade paper, and the skills to try your hand at creating with plant material. No prior experience required.
Each participant will make one boat basket with cattail and 3-4 (maybe 5) pieces of paper with cattail in two different sizes (postcard and letter size). Tickets are 60$ and include all materials.
